21. "VR stories are so commonplace in printed science fiction"
In response to Reply # 0


          

(comic-form or otherwise) that when I read the book (which I liked a whole lot), the comparison didn't even hit me.

It's obvious that anything involving VR and sci-fi is going to owe a debt to Neuromancer and Gibson's other works, just like The Matrix does.

Hell, Tron covered many of the same themes in 1982. Did you ever say 'Why do I need to see The Matrix when I've already seen Tron?'

46. "I thought it was quite good."
In response to Reply # 0


  

          

It was a really well-thought-out future world, with a history and all sorts of great details.

The plot itself was fine, fairly standard. The performances? Well, Bruce Willis does better at looking beat up than ANYONE. I liked the moments where we saw the human versions of the actors the best in terms of acting.

And with thrills... Jonathan Mostow creates tension as well as any big-name action director. When the girl throws a fucking parking meter at Bruce Willis? Shiiiiiit.

A solid 2.5-3 out of 4 stars. Worth seeing for sci-fi nerds.
